/*****************************************************************************//* Software Testing Automation Framework (STAF)                              *//* (C) Copyright IBM Corp. 2001                                              *//*                                                                           *//* This software is licensed under the Common Public License (CPL) V1.0.     *//*****************************************************************************/#include "STAFOSTypes.h"#include "STAFProcessManager.h"#include "STAFProc.h"#include "STAFException.h"#include "STAFThreadManager.h"STAFProcessManager::STAFProcessManager(){    APIRET rc = DosCreateQueue(&fQueueHandle, QUE_FIFO,                               (PSZ)"\\QUEUES\\STAFProc");    STAFException::checkRC(0, "DosCreateQueue", rc);    gThreadManagerPtr->dispatch(new STAFThreadFunc(callHandleQueue, this));}STAFProcessManager::~STAFProcessManager(){    /* Do Nothing */}void STAFProcessManager::callHandleQueue(STAFThreadFunctionData_t thisPtr){    STAFProcessManager *self = (STAFProcessManager *)thisPtr;    self->handleQueue();}void STAFProcessManager::handleQueue(){    APIRET rc = 0;    REQUESTDATA requestData = { 0 };    ULONG dataLength = 0;    QueueData *data = 0;    BYTE priority = 0;    for(;;)    {        try        {            rc = DosReadQueue(fQueueHandle, &requestData, &dataLength,                              (void **)&data, 0, DCWW_WAIT, &priority, 0);            STAFException::checkRC(0, "DosReadQueue", rc);            ProcessMonitorList::iterator iter;            STAFMutexSemLock processLock(fQueueMonitorListSem);            for(iter = fQueueMonitorList.begin();                (iter != fQueueMonitorList.end()) &&                    (iter->handle != data->childSessionID);                ++iter);            if (iter != fQueueMonitorList.end())            {                ProcessMonitorInfo processMonitorInfo = *iter;                 fQueueMonitorList.erase(iter);                fQueueMonitorListSem.release();                if (processMonitorInfo.callback != 0)                {                    processMonitorInfo.callback(processMonitorInfo.pid,                                                data->childRC);                }            }            rc = DosFreeMem((void *)data);            STAFException::checkRC(0, "DosFreeMem", rc);        }        catch (STAFException &e)        {            e.write();        }        catch (...)        {            cout << "Caught unknown exception" << endl;        }    }}STAFError::ID STAFProcessManager::startProcess(    const ProcessInitInfo &processInit, STAFProcessID &pid,    unsigned int &osRC, ProcessTermCallback callback){    STARTDATA startData = { 0 };    STAFStringBufferPtr commandBuffer = processInit.command.toCurrentCodePage();    STAFStringBufferPtr parmsBuffer = processInit.parms.toCurrentCodePage();    STAFStringBufferPtr titleBuffer = processInit.title.toCurrentCodePage();    startData.Length = 30;    startData.Related = SSF_RELATED_CHILD;    startData.TraceOpt = SSF_TRACEOPT_NONE;    startData.PgmTitle = 0;    startData.PgmName = reinterpret_cast<PSZ>(                        const_cast<char *>(commandBuffer->buffer()));    startData.PgmInputs = reinterpret_cast<PSZ>(                          const_cast<char *>(parmsBuffer->buffer()));    startData.TermQ = (unsigned char *)"\\QUEUES\\STAFProc";    startData.Environment = reinterpret_cast<BYTE *>(processInit.environment);    startData.InheritOpt = SSF_INHERTOPT_PARENT;    APIRET rc = 0;    if (processInit.foregroundBackground == kForeground)        startData.FgBg = SSF_FGBG_FORE;    else        startData.FgBg = SSF_FGBG_BACK;    if (processInit.title.length() != 0)    {        startData.PgmTitle = reinterpret_cast<PSZ>(                             const_cast<char *>(titleBuffer->buffer()));    }    if (processInit.workdir.length() != 0)    {        STAFMutexSemLock dirSemLock(*gDirectorySemPtr);        APIRET baseRC = 0;        unsigned long driveNum = 0;        STAFString dirName = processInit.workdir;        if (dirName.toCurrentCodePage()->buffer()[1] == ':')        {            // Determine correct drive letter and change to that disk            driveNum = dirName.toUpperCase().toCurrentCodePage()->buffer()[0] -                       64;            baseRC = DosSetDefaultDisk(driveNum);            if (baseRC != 0)            {                osRC = (unsigned int)baseRC;                return STAFError::kBaseOSError;            }            dirName = dirName.subString(3);        }        baseRC = DosSetCurrentDir(reinterpret_cast<PSZ>(                 const_cast<char *>(dirName.toCurrentCodePage()->buffer())));        if (baseRC)        {            osRC = (unsigned int)baseRC;            return STAFError::kBaseOSError;        }    }    ProcessMonitorInfo processMonitorInfo(0, 0, callback);    rc = DosStartSession(&startData, &processMonitorInfo.handle,                         &processMonitorInfo.pid);    if ((rc != 0) && (rc != ERROR_SMG_START_IN_BACKGROUND))    {        osRC = (unsigned int)rc;        return STAFError::kBaseOSError;    }    pid = processMonitorInfo.pid;    // Add process handle to list    STAFMutexSemLock lock(fQueueMonitorListSem);    fQueueMonitorList.push_back(processMonitorInfo);    return STAFError::kOk;}STAFError::ID STAFProcessManager::stopProcess(STAFProcessID pid,                                              unsigned int &osRC){    STAFMutexSemLock monitorListLock(fQueueMonitorListSem);    ProcessMonitorInfo processMonitorInfo;    ProcessMonitorList::iterator iter;    for(iter = fQueueMonitorList.begin(); iter != fQueueMonitorList.end() &&        (iter->pid != pid); ++iter)    { /* Do Nothing */ }    if (iter != fQueueMonitorList.end())    {        APIRET rc = DosStopSession(STOP_SESSION_SPECIFIED,                                   iter->handle);        if (rc != 0)        {            osRC = (unsigned int)rc;            return STAFError::kBaseOSError;        }    }    else return STAFError::kHandleDoesNotExist;    return STAFError::kOk;}STAFError::ID STAFProcessManager::registerForProcessTermination(    STAFProcessID pid, unsigned int &osRC, ProcessTermCallback callback){    return STAFError::kInvalidAPI;}
